Pediatric Dental Care: Tips for Parents

Ensuring your child's dental health is vital for their overall well-being. Here are some essential tips for parents to promote good dental habits from an early age.

Start Early

Begin cleaning your child's gums even before their first tooth appears. Use a soft cloth to wipe their gums and establish a routine.

Teach Proper Brushing

Once your child has teeth, teach them to brush twice a day with fluoride toothpaste. Supervise their brushing until they are old enough to do it independently.

Limit Sugary Snacks

Encourage healthy snacks and limit sugary treats to reduce the risk of cavities. Offer fruits, vegetables, and whole grains instead.

Regular Dental Visits

Schedule regular dental check-ups for your child. Early visits help familiarize them with the dentist and establish a positive relationship.
